
The upcoming second season of Tsukimichi: Moonlit Fantasy has revealed new cast members ahead of its January 2024 premiere. The first season of the isekai anime series aired from July to September 2021, and J.C. Staff is taking over from C2C as the animation studio for Season 2.
The additional cast are as follows (from left to right):
Jin Rohan voiced by Yuki Shin
Abelia Hopleys voiced by Yurie Kozakai
Misra Cazper voiced by Shinsuke Sugawara
Izumi Ikusabe voiced by Tatsumaru Tachibana
Daena Severus voiced by Tomohiro Yamaguchi
Sif Rembrandt voiced by Yumiri Hanamori
Yuno Rembrandt voiced by Nene Hieda
Ilumgand Hopleys voiced by Kento Ito
Eva voiced by Shiori Izawa
Luria voiced by Yuki Hirose
Tsukimichi: Moonlit Fantasy Season 2 is directed by Shinji Ishihira (Log Horizon), and Kenta Ihara (Saga of Tanya the Evil) is in charge of the series composition while Yukie Suzuki is working on the character designs.
What is Tsukimichi: Moonlit Fantasy Season 2 about?
Tsukimichi: Moonlit Fantasy is based on the light novels by Kei Azumi and Mitsuaki Matsumoto, and the first season of the anime roughly covered the first four volumes of the series. If Season 2 is based on the next four chapters, it's likely that we will see Makoto enroll as a student at the Rotsgard academy, where he's surprised to find out that he's qualified to become a teacher himself. Due to his difficult, combat-focused lessons, his students don't get along with him, but he eventually earns their respect. In Volume 7 of the light novels, a major event happens: a school festival, in which Makoto's students join a fighting tournament. It's likely that we will see these plot points unfold in the second season.
Crunchyroll shared a story description for the fantasy adventure:
Makoto Misumi was just an average teenager who suddenly was summoned to another world as a "hero." But the goddess of this world called him ugly and took his hero status away from him, then sent him to the ends of the world. He meets dragons, spiders, orcs, dwarves, and many other non-human races in the wastelands. Makoto manages to show promise in the use of magic and fighting, which he wouldn't have been able to do in his former world. He has numerous encounters, but will he be able to survive this new world? A fantasy where a guy who gods and humanity had abandoned tries to reset his life in this new world is about to begin!
